Star Wars: The Force Unleashed for PS2
LucasArts will released in September the PS2 version of Star Wars: The Force Unleashed. Star Wars: The Force Unleashed casts players as Darth Vader’s “Secret Apprentice” and promises to unveil new revelations about the Star Wars galaxy. The game’s story is set during the largely unexplored era between Star Wars: Episode III Revenge of the Sith and Star Wars: Episode IV A New Hope. In it, players will assist Vader in his quest to rid the universe of Jedi.
Gameplay of Star Wars: The Force Unleashed
Though the story and characters are consistent across all platforms, specific details vary between them — for example, the opening level on Kashyyyk is a daytime attack on the Xbox 360 and the PS3, while the Wii, PSP and PS2 depictions happen at night with different levels. LucasArts plans to offer downloadable expansions for both the PS3 and Xbox 360 versions: one content package will make characters other than Starkiller playable throughout the game, and a later package will add a new mission. The Wii, PlayStation 2, and PSP versions - all developed by Krome Studios - allow the player’s character to participate in Jedi trials, encountering the spirits of long-dead Jedi.
